A GEWA Bow Designed for Learning
Designed to accompany the first years of practice, this bow stamped "GEWA" aims for a good balance between maneuverability, durability, and consistency. Its round stick promotes a natural grip and progressive control, particularly useful during beginner lessons and junior orchestra.
For Whom and For What Uses?
This model is intended for beginners and young musicians playing on a 1/4 violin. It is perfectly suited for study repertoire (methods, scales, small classical pieces) and styles requiring simple and clean articulation, without demanding advanced bowing technique.
Sound Quality
The natural hair provides a firm grip, facilitating string vibration and stability of bow strokes (détaché, legato). The ebony frog contributes to a more precise control feel, while the nickel silver mount enhances robustness for regular use.
Recommended Compatible Accessories
To get the best from this bow, the use of violin rosin is recommended to optimize hair grip and attack quality.

Questions frequently asked
Is this bow compatible with a 1/4 violin?
This model is designed for the 1/4 size and is intended for young musicians playing on a violin of this size.
Is the round carbon stick suitable for a beginner?
The round carbon stick promotes a natural grip and progressive control. Its construction is intended for the first years of practice and regular use in lessons.
What type of hair does the Gewa 1/4 round carbon bow use?
Natural hair provides a firm grip on the string, facilitating sound production. It contributes to the stability of bow strokes such as détaché and legato.
What rosin should be used with this violin bow?
A violin rosin is recommended to optimize the grip of the natural hair and the quality of articulation.
What materials make up the frog of this bow?
The frog and the slide are made of ebony, with a mother-of-pearl eye. The mount is made of nickel silver to reinforce the overall strength. The bow bears the stamped mark « GEWA ».
